Easy No-Bake Cheesecake with White Chocolate Pudding Mix
Ingredients Needed: Cream Cheese, White Chocolate Instant Pudding Mix, Graham Cracker Crust, Whipped Cream
You don’t need a long list of ingredients to create a delicious no-bake cheesecake. You can easily whip up a creamy and indulgent dessert with just a few simple staples. Here’s what you’ll need:
- Cream Cheese – This is the base of your cheesecake, providing that signature rich, tangy flavor and smooth texture. Use full-fat cream cheese for the best results, as it helps create the desired creamy consistency.
- White Chocolate Instant Pudding Mix – This is the key ingredient to infuse sweetness and flavor into your cheesecake without baking. The instant pudding mix thickens the filling, making it set nicely in the crust while providing a white chocolate flavor that complements the cream cheese.
- Graham Cracker Crust – A simple pre-made graham cracker crust works perfectly for this recipe. Its sweet, crunchy texture provides a contrast to the creamy filling. You can also make your crust by mixing crushed graham crackers with melted butter.
- Whipped Cream – Whipped cream is essential for lightening up the filling, giving the cheesecake an airy, fluffy texture. It also adds a hint of sweetness. You can use store-bought whipped cream or whip your own for a fresher taste.
Step-by-Step Instructions: How to Mix and Set the Cheesecake
Making this no-bake cheesecake is as easy as mixing the ingredients and allowing them to set in the fridge. Here’s how to do it:
- Prepare the Crust:
If you’re using a store-bought graham cracker crust, simply place it on your serving dish. If you’re making your own, crush about 1 ½ cups of graham crackers and mix them with ¼ cup melted butter. Press this mixture into a pie or springform pan and chill for about 10 minutes to firm up. - Prepare the Filling:
In a large bowl, beat 2 blocks of cream cheese until smooth and creamy. Add the white chocolate instant pudding mix (about 1 box or the amount specified in your recipe). Slowly add 1 ½ cups of cold milk and beat until everything is well combined. You’ll notice the pudding mix starting to thicken as you mix. - Add Whipped Cream:
In a separate bowl, whip about 1 cup of heavy cream until stiff peaks form. Gently fold this whipped cream into the cream cheese and pudding mixture. The whipped cream lightens the filling, giving it a fluffy texture that sets beautifully. - Assemble the Cheesecake:
Pour the prepared cheesecake filling into your chilled graham cracker crust, smoothing the top with a spatula. Refrigerate the cheesecake for at least 4 hours, or until it’s firm and set. If you have more time, letting it chill overnight will give the flavors even more time to develop.

White Chocolate Mousse with Cream Cheese
Ingredients Needed: White Chocolate Pudding Mix, Cream Cheese, Heavy Cream, Vanilla Extract
To create this whipped white chocolate mousse, the ingredient list is straightforward, featuring just a handful of creamy and indulgent components. Here’s what you’ll need:
- White Chocolate Pudding Mix – This is the key ingredient to give the mousse its sweet, velvety texture. The pudding mix thickens and creates a creamy consistency that forms the foundation of the mousse. It also provides a light white chocolate flavor without needing to melt actual chocolate.
- Cream Cheese – Cream cheese adds richness and tanginess, which helps to balance the sweetness of the pudding mix. It also contributes to the mousse’s smooth and luxurious texture. For the best results, use full-fat cream cheese for a richer taste and creamier consistency.
- Heavy Cream – Heavy cream is what gives the mousse its light and airy texture. When whipped, it adds volume and makes the mousse fluffy and soft. The cream helps to create the melt-in-your-mouth experience that makes this dessert irresistible.
- Vanilla Extract – A touch of vanilla extract enhances the overall flavor, rounding out the sweetness from the pudding mix and providing a subtle depth of flavor. It complements the white chocolate and cream cheese, bringing everything together perfectly.
How to Make It: Simple Steps to Whip Up a Light and Airy Mousse
Making this whipped white chocolate mousse is incredibly simple and quick. Follow these easy steps to create a delicious dessert:
- Prepare the Pudding Mix:
In a large mixing bowl, combine 1 box of white chocolate instant pudding mix with 2 cups of cold milk. Whisk the mixture for about 2 minutes until it thickens, then set it aside. - Mix the Cream Cheese:
In a separate bowl, beat about 8 oz of cream cheese until smooth and creamy. You can soften the cream cheese beforehand by letting it sit at room temperature for 10-15 minutes to make mixing easier. - Combine the Pudding and Cream Cheese:
Gently fold the prepared white chocolate pudding mixture into the cream cheese. Beat everything together until fully combined and smooth. - Whip the Heavy Cream:
In another bowl, whip 1 cup of heavy cream using an electric mixer until it forms stiff peaks. This will give the mousse its light and airy texture. - Fold in the Whipped Cream:
Gently fold the whipped cream into the pudding and cream cheese mixture, making sure not to deflate the cream. Use a spatula to mix until you have a smooth and fluffy mousse. - Chill and Serve:
Transfer the mousse to serving bowls or glasses and ref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or until fully set. The mousse will firm up slightly in the fridge but remain light and airy.

No-Bake White Chocolate Cream Cheese Truffles
Ingredients Needed: White Chocolate Pudding Mix, Cream Cheese, Crushed Cookies, Powdered Sugar
To make these white chocolate cream cheese truffles, you only need a handful of simple yet indulgent ingredients that combine to create a creamy, sweet treat. Here’s the list of essentials:
- White Chocolate Pudding Mix – This instant pudding mix provides the truffles with a creamy texture and a rich white chocolate flavor. It also helps thicken the mixture, making it easier to roll into truffle shapes.
- Cream Cheese – Cream cheese is key to the soft, rich filling of these truffles. It adds a tangy note that balances the sweetness from the pudding mix and gives the truffles their smooth, creamy consistency. Use full-fat cream cheese for the best texture and flavor.
- Crushed Cookies – For a bit of texture and crunch, crushed cookies are added to the mix. Cookies like graham crackers or chocolate wafer cookies complement the creamy filling while adding a subtle flavor that enhances the overall taste.
- Powdered Sugar – Powdered sugar is used to sweeten the truffle mixture without adding any grittiness. It helps create the perfect consistency for rolling and coating the truffles, making them melt-in-your-mouth delicious.
How to Prepare: Rolling, Chilling, and Coating the Truffles
Making these white chocolate cream cheese truffles is simple, with just a few easy steps:
- Prepare the Truffle Mixture:
In a large mixing bowl, combine 8 oz of softened cream cheese with 1 box of white chocolate instant pudding mix. Stir well until the mixture is smooth and fully combined. - Add Crushed Cookies and Powdered Sugar:
Add about 1 cup of crushed cookies (such as graham crackers or chocolate wafers) to the mixture, followed by 1/2 cup powdered sugar. Mix everything until you have a smooth, thick dough-like consistency. - Roll into Truffle Balls:
Take small portions of the mixture and roll them into 1-inch balls using your hands. If the mixture is too sticky, you can chill it in the fridge for 15 minutes to make rolling easier. - Chill the Truffles:
Once the truffles are rolled, place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and chill them in the fridge for at least 30 minutes. This allows them to firm up and makes them easier to coat. - Coat the Truffles:
After chilling, coat the truffles in your desired coating (details on creative variations below). You can roll them in powdered sugar, cocoa powder, or even crushed nuts for extra flavor and texture. - Final Chill:
After coating, place the truffles back in the fridge to set for at least 30 minutes, ensuring they stay firm and the coating sticks well.

Storage Tips: How to Keep Them Fresh for Longer
To ensure that your white chocolate cream cheese truffles stay fresh and delicious, proper storage is key. Here are a few tips:
- Refrigerate:
Since these truffles contain cream cheese, it’s important to store them in the fridge to keep them fresh. Place them in an airtight container to prevent them from absorbing any other odors from the fridge. - Shelf Life:
When stored properly, white chocolate cream cheese truffles will stay fresh for up to one week in the refrigerator. If you need to keep them for longer, you can freeze the truffles. - Freezing:
To freeze the truffles, place them on a baking sheet and freeze until firm. Then transfer them to a freezer-safe container or zip-top bag. Frozen truffles can last for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to enjoy them, let them thaw in the fridge for a few hours.

Quick & Easy White Chocolate Cream Cheese Parfait
Ingredients Needed: White Chocolate Pudding Mix, Cream Cheese, Crushed Biscuits, Whipped Cream, Fruit
These white chocolate cream cheese parfaits come together beautifully with just a few simple 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need to create this sweet and creamy treat:
- White Chocolate Pudding Mix – The instant white chocolate pudding mix provides the base for the creamy filling, contributing a rich chocolate flavor and smooth consistency.
- Cream Cheese – The cream cheese adds a tangy element and enhances the texture, making the parfait filling wonderfully smooth and creamy.
- Crushed Biscuits – Crushed biscuits (or cookies) create a crunchy layer that contrasts perfectly with the creamy filling. Digestive biscuits, graham crackers, or Oreos work great as they provide a rich flavor and crispy texture.
- Whipped Cream – To achieve the light, fluffy texture of the parfait, whipped cream is added to the filling. It lightens up the dense cream cheese and pudding mixture, creating a cloud-like consistency.
- Fruit – For a fresh and fruity touch, add seasonal fruit like berries, bananas, or mango. The fruit adds both color and sweetness, complementing the rich, creamy layers.
Layering Guide: How to Assemble the Perfect Parfait
Assembling the parfaits is the fun part! Here’s a simple guide to layering your parfaits to perfection:
- Start with the Biscuit Base:
Begin by spooning a layer of crushed biscuits into the bottom of your serving cups or mason jars. Press them down lightly to create a solid foundation. - Add the Cream Cheese Mixture:
Next, layer the cream cheese and white chocolate pudding mixture on top of the biscuit base. Use a spoon to smooth the mixture evenly, creating a smooth and creamy layer. - Add Whipped Cream:
Spoon a generous amount of whipped cream on top of the cream cheese mixture. This layer should be light and fluffy, adding volume to the parfait. - Fruit Layer:
Top the whipped cream with a layer of fresh fruit. Use fruits like strawberries, raspberries, blueberries, or sliced bananas for a pop of color and sweetness. - Repeat Layers:
Repeat the process of layering crushed biscuits, the cream cheese mixture, whipped cream, and fruit until you reach the top of the jar or cup. End with a decorative layer of fruit on top to give the parfait an appealing finish. - Chill and Set:
Once assembled, chill the parfaits in the fridge for at least 2 hours to allow the flavors to meld and the parfait to set. This ensures the parfait holds its shape when served.
